Output eea17d32a9989b1c4ea779ba2882b697735d60c87d6f06eae258c983120c139d:12

value
80899000
script pubkey
OP_0 OP_PUSHBYTES_20 59e039bd0bbb8627baf9c742971a4224750ed269
address
bc1qt8srn0gthwrz0whecapfwxjzy36sa5nfg47mdw
transaction
eea17d32a9989b1c4ea779ba2882b697735d60c87d6f06eae258c983120c139d
confirmations
171290
spent
true